Technical Lead

0 years

0 Lacs

Posted:4 weeks 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

About the Role

We are seeking an experienced and innovative Full Stack Technical Lead to join our dynamic team. The ideal candidate is a hands-on leader who can architect, design, and lead the development of high-performance, scalable applications. This role requires deep expertise across the full stack—front-end (React or Vue) and back-end (Python or Node.js)—with a specific focus on leveraging Generative AI for rapid application development. You will be instrumental in building the next generation of intelligent, user-centric applications, providing technical leadership, and mentoring a team of talented engineers.

Key Responsibilities

  • Technical Leadership & Architecture:
  • Serve as the technical authority for the team, guiding architectural decisions and ensuring the design of robust, scalable, and secure systems.
  • Lead the full software development lifecycle from ideation and requirements gathering to deployment and maintenance.
  • Conduct code reviews, enforce coding standards, and ensure the delivery of high-quality, clean code.
  • Hands-on Development:
  • Design, develop, and maintain front-end applications using either React or Vue.js, ensuring a responsive and intuitive user experience.
  • Build and maintain scalable back-end services and APIs using Python or Node.js.
  • Integrate and orchestrate various Generative AI models (e.g., LLMs, image generation models) to build innovative, AI-powered features.
  • Generative AI Application Development:
  • Drive the rapid development and prototyping of Gen AI-powered applications.
  • Develop and implement prompt engineering strategies to optimize model performance and output.
  • Architect and implement solutions using frameworks and tools for Gen AI, such as LangChain, LlamaIndex, or similar.
  • Utilize vector databases (e.g., Pinecone, ChromaDB) and techniques like Retrieval-Augmented Generation (RAG) to build context-aware applications.
  • Stay up-to-date with the latest advancements in Gen AI, machine learning, and AI-powered development tools to continuously enhance our product offerings.
  • Team & Project Management:
  • Mentor and coach junior and mid-level developers, fostering a culture of technical excellence and continuous learning.
  • Collaborate with product managers, designers, and other stakeholders to translate business requirements into technical solutions.
  • Manage project timelines, allocate resources, and ensure timely delivery of features.

Required Skills & Qualifications

  • Full Stack Expertise:
  • Proven experience as a Full Stack Developer or Technical Lead.
  • Front-End: Strong proficiency in either React and/or Vue.js. Expertise in state management (Redux/Zustand or Vuex/Pinia), component-based architecture, and modern JavaScript (ES6+).
  • Back-End: Deep experience with either Python (e.g., Flask, Django) or Node.js (e.g., Express.js, NestJS).
  • Databases: Proficiency with both SQL (e.g., PostgreSQL, MySQL) and NoSQL (e.g., MongoDB) databases.
  • APIs: Extensive experience in designing and building RESTful APIs or GraphQL services.
  • Generative AI Development:
  • Practical experience in building applications that integrate with and utilize Generative AI models (e.g., OpenAI's GPT, Google Gemini, Anthropic's Claude).
  • Hands-on experience with AI-specific frameworks like LangChain, LlamaIndex, or Hugging Face.
  • Familiarity with prompt engineering techniques and the ability to optimize model interactions for specific use cases.
  • Experience with vector databases and RAG architecture is a significant plus.
  • Leadership & Soft Skills:
  • Prior experience in a leadership role, with a track record of mentoring and managing development teams.
  • Excellent problem-solving, analytical, and communication skills.
  • Ability to work in a fast-paced, agile environment and manage multiple priorities effectively.

Preferred Qualifications

  • Experience with cloud platforms (AWS, Azure, GCP) and DevOps practices (Docker, CI/CD, Kubernetes).
  • Knowledge of microservices architecture.
  • Contributions to open-source projects, particularly in the Gen AI or full-stack domains.
  • A bachelor's or master's degree in Computer Science, Engineering, or a related field.

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You

hyderabad, chennai, bengaluru

hyderabad, pune, bengaluru